3. MFP INSTALLATION
3.1 Precautions and Prohibition
Warning
Do not install the MFP in the vicinity of high temperature or re.
Do not install the MFP at the place where a chemical reaction may take place
(laboratory, etc.).
Do
not install the MFP near flammable solution like alcohol, thinner, etc.
Do not install the MFP at the place where a small child can reach.
Do not install the MFP at an unstable place (unsteady frame, tilted place, etc.).
Do not install the MFP at a highly humid or dusty place or under the direct sunshine.
Do not install the MFP under the environment of sea breeze or caustic gas.
Do not install the MFP at a highly vibrating place.
When you drop the MFP or damage the cover, remove the power plug from the outlet
and contact the Customers Service Center.
El
ectric shock, fire or injury may occur.
Do not connect the power cord, printer cable and earth wire as otherwise directed by
the Manual. Are may break out.
Do
not insert a thing in the vent hole.
Electric shock, fire or injury may occur.
Do not place a cup with water on the MFP.
Electric shock orre may occur.
Do not touch the fuser unit when you open the printer cover.
Burn may occur.
Do not throw the toner cartridge or image drum cartridge intore.
Burn may occur by the dust explosion.
Do not use a highlyammable spray near the MFP.
Fire may break out as there are high temperature parts inside the printer.
When the cover becomes abnormally hot, a smoke arises or a strange odor comes
out, remove the power plug from the outlet and contact the Customers Service Center.
Fi
re may break out.
When liquid like water drops inside the MFP, remove the power plug from the outlet
and contact the Customers Service Center.
Fi
re may break out.
When a thing like a clip drops inside the MFP, remove the power plug from the outlet
and take out that thing.
Do
not operate or disassemble the MFP as otherwise directed in the Manual.
Electric shock, fire or injury may occur.
Caution
Do not install the MFP at the place where the vent hole is blocked.
Do not install the MFP on the shaggy carpet.
Do not install the MFP at the place with little draught or without ventilation like a room
with no window.
In
stall the MFP away from the monitor TV.
When the MFP is to be moved, hold both ends of the printer.
This MFP weighs about 29kg and should be lifted by 2 or more persons.
When to switch the power on or while printing, do not come near the paper exit of the
MFP.
In
jury may occur.
As regards the items of caution, explain to the customer showing the items of caution of the
User’s Manual. Particularly, explain fully about the power supply cord and earth cable.

Oki MC561 Specifications

Printing Specifications IconPrinting Specifications
Print SpeedUp to 27 ppm color, 31 ppm black & white
Time to First PageAs fast as 8 seconds in color, 7.5 seconds in black & white
Print ResolutionUp to 1200 x 600 dpi
Copying Specifications IconCopying Specifications
Copy SpeedUp to 27 cpm color, 31 cpm black & white
First Copy OutAs fast as 14 seconds in color, 12 seconds in black & white
Copy ResolutionUp to 600 x 600 dpi
Scanning Specifications IconScanning Specifications
Scan TypeColor and black & white flatbed
Scan ResolutionUp to 1200 x 1200 dpi
Scan SpeedApprox. 3 sec./page color, approx 2 sec./page black & white at 300 dpi
Fax Specifications IconFax Specifications
Fax Modem33.6 Kbps Super G3
Transmission Speed3 seconds/page
Fax ResolutionUp to 200 x 400 dpi
System Memory IconSystem Memory
Standard Imaging RAM256 MB
Max Imaging RAM768 MB
SD Card Storage4 GB standard; 16 GB optional
Paper Handling IconPaper Handling
Scanner RADF CapacityUp to 50 letter/legal sheets
Standard Input350 sheets (250 sheets via Main Tray + 100 sheets via MPT)
Maximum Input880 sheets (with optional 530-sheet 2nd Paper Tray)
Environmental Specifications IconEnvironmental Specifications
Size16.8" x 20" x 17.5" (42.7 cm x 50.9 cm x 44.4 cm)
Weight63 lb. (29 kg)
Power ConsumptionOperating Normal 570W; Max 1170W; Idle 100W; Power Save 20W; Deep Sleep <1.5W
